Kenneth Yee

Kenneth Yee is a celebrated Hong Kong art director and production designer whose visionary work has shaped the visual identity of Asian cinema for decades.

What do we know about Kenneth Yee?

Here are the key biographical details about Kenneth Yee:

  • Name: Kenneth Yee
  • Also Known As: Kenneth Yee, Chung Man Yee, Hai Chung-Man
  • Date of Birth: November 24, 1951
  • Place of Birth: Hong Kong, British Crown Colony
  • Gender: Male
  • Job Title: Art Director
  • Crew Jobs: Art Direction, Costume Design, Production Design, Producer, Director
